In chapter 4, there is a Microsoft Tag, though it looks like art. When read by a specific smart phone app, you'll unlock a secret. You'll be given access to several themes for your Xbox 360, as sponsored by Verizon.

At the start of episode 4, upstairs near Alan's room is an Xbox 360 and a copy of Night Springs.

In the fictional Alan Wake interview, Sam Lake makes a cameo. As an added bonus he does the infamous "Max Payne" face.
